What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Remote Data Scientist,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Data Scientist, you need strong analytical skills, proficiency in statistics, and a solid background in mathematics or computer science, often supported by a relevant degree. Expertise in programming languages such as Python or R, familiarity with machine learning libraries, and experience with cloud-based data platforms are typically required. Excellent communication, self-motivation, and time management skills help you effectively collaborate and deliver results in a remote environment. These skills ensure accurate data analysis, meaningful insights, and successful teamwork despite physical distance.

How do remote data scientists typically collaborate with cross-functional teams to deliver insights?

Remote data scientists often work closely with product managers, engineers, and business analysts using digital collaboration tools such as Slack, Zoom, and project management platforms. Regular virtual meetings, code sharing via Git repositories, and clear documentation are essential to ensure alignment and transparency. While working remotely can present challenges in communication, proactive updates and scheduled syncs help foster strong teamwork and keep projects on track.

What Are the Qualifications to Get a Remote Data Science Job?

The qualifications for a remote data scientist depend in large part on your employer and their industry. Most employers expect remote data science professionals to have at least a bachelor’s degree in statistics, math, computer science, or a related field. Some expect postgraduate degrees in a field like data mining or machine learning or demonstrable skills in these areas. As a remote worker, you need access to relevant programs and an internet connection. You may also want to pursue certification, such as becoming a Certified Analytics Professional (CAP).

What is the difference between Remote Data Science vs Remote Data Analyst?

AspectRemote Data ScienceRemote Data Analyst
Required CredentialsDegree in Data Science, Statistics, or related field; programming skills in Python/R; knowledge of machine learningDegree in Statistics, Mathematics, or related field; proficiency in Excel, SQL, and data visualization tools
Work EnvironmentCollaborative teams, research-focused, often involves building models and algorithmsData reporting, visualization, and interpreting data trends for decision-making
Employer & Industry UsageTech companies, finance, healthcare, e-commerceMarketing agencies, retail, finance, healthcare

Remote Data Science involves developing predictive models and advanced analytics, requiring programming and machine learning skills. Remote Data Analysts focus on interpreting data, creating reports, and visualizations. While both roles analyze data remotely, Data Scientists typically handle more complex modeling tasks, whereas Data Analysts focus on data interpretation and reporting.
